Concatenate strings

Two strings can be concatenated by placing a .. symbol between them. It is very important to have at least one space on both the left and right of the .. symbol. Concatenating two strings results in a new string, which can be stored in a variable or used in its place. Any combination of variables and literals can be concatenated, as the following code demonstrates:
